PCS stands for Power Conversion System. In the energy industry, especially in solar and battery energy storage systems (BESS), a PCS is a vital unit that controls the conversion between DC (Direct Current) and AC (Alternating Current). Bulgaria inaugurated a record-breaking battery energy storage system (BESS) with a capacity of 124 MW/496. According to a statement from the Ministry of Energy, the facility is the largest BESS in the entire European Union. 1 MW in operating power was inaugurated in Lovech in Bulgaria. Located next to a photovoltaic park within Balkan Industrial Park, it is part of the country's first closed licensed power distribution system.
